Identify the warning signs of electrical overloading Identify the warning signs of electrical overloading

Electrical overloading is a serious issue that can cause power outages and even fires in your office. To prevent this, it’s important to identify the warning signs of electrical overloading.

There are several warning signs that can indicate an electrical overload in your office. These include:

  1. Flickering or dimming lights: If your lights are flickering or dimming when you use certain appliances, this could be a sign of an electrical overload.
  2. Constant tripping of circuit breakers: A circuit breaker that trips frequently could indicate that there is too much power being drawn from the circuit.
  3. Burning smells: If you smell burning near outlets or light switches, this could mean that the wiring is overheating due to an electrical overload.
  4. Hot outlets or switches: Outlets and light switches should never feel hot. If they do, this could be another sign of an electrical overload.

It’s important to pay attention to these warning signs and take action if you notice any of them in your office. Ignoring them could lead to more serious problems down the road.

Determine the capacity of your electrical system

To avoid overloading your office’s electrical system, it is essential to determine its capacity. Here’s a 4-step guide to help you determine the capacity of your electrical system:

  1. Locate the main circuit breaker or fuse box in your office.
  2. Check the label on the panel cover for its amperage rating. The amperage rating tells you how many amps of current the entire electrical panel can handle.
  3. Calculate the total amperage your office’s appliances and electronics draw by adding up their respective amperages shown on each device or appliance label.
  4. Ensure that the total amperage of all equipment and devices does not exceed the amperage rating of your electrical panel.

Keep in mind that some appliances, such as air conditioners or space heaters, draw a lot of power and should be given special consideration during this assessment.

The next step is determining if your electrical system has enough capacity to power everything in your office without overloading it. If you find that your equipment demands more amperage than what your system can handle, proceed to upgrade it.

Use power strips and surge protectors

Use power strips and surge protectors to keep your office safe from electrical overloading. Here are six steps to use them correctly:

  1. Choose the right power strip for the job. Make sure it has a built-in circuit breaker and is rated for the amount of electricity you need.
  2. Plug in all of your electronic devices into the power strip.
  3. For added safety, plug the power strip into a surge protector.
  4. Keep an eye on the number of devices you have plugged in at once. Avoid plugging too many devices into one outlet.
  5. Periodically inspect your power strips and surge protectors for damage or wear-and-tear.
  6. Replace any damaged or worn-out power strips or surge protectors immediately.

Using power strips and surge protectors can help prevent overloading in your office by distributing electricity evenly among multiple devices while protecting against sudden surges of voltage that could cause damage. However, it’s important to stay vigilant and keep an eye on the number of devices you have plugged in at once to ensure that you’re not overloading any individual outlets.

Avoid using extension cords excessively

Avoid using extension cords excessively

To avoid electrical overloading in your office, it is important to avoid using extension cords excessively. Here are 5 points to help you understand why:

  1. Extension cords are not designed for constant use and can become damaged easily.
  2. Overloading an extension cord can cause it to heat up and start a fire.
  3. Running wires under rugs or furniture can create a tripping hazard and damage the cords.
  4. Having too many devices plugged into one strip can overload the circuit and cause a power outage.
  5. Using too many extension cords can also make it difficult to track which device is plugged into which outlet, which can cause confusion and errors.

It is important to keep in mind that overusing extension cords for long periods of time can lead to serious problems such as overheating and fires. Therefore, be mindful of how many devices you have plugged into an extension cord or power strip at any given time.

Frequently Asked Questions

What is electrical overloading in an office?

Electrical overloading is a condition when the electrical circuit of an office is subjected to more current than it can handle, leading to overheating, damage, or even electrical fires.

What are the common causes of electrical overloading in an office?

Common causes of electrical overloading in an office include the use of too many electrical appliances on one circuit, using extension cords extensively, old or faulty wiring, and outdated electrical panels.

How can I prevent electrical overloading in my office?

You can prevent electrical overloading in your office by avoiding the use of too many appliances on a single circuit, using power strips with surge protectors, upgrading your electrical panels, replacing old wiring, and knowing the rated capacity of each circuit.

Is it safe to plug multiple devices into one power strip?

Yes, it’s safe to plug multiple devices into one power strip, but you need to make sure that the total electrical load of the devices doesn’t exceed the capacity of the power strip or the circuit that the power strip is plugged into.

Can electrical overloading cause a fire?

Yes, electrical overloading can cause a fire if the overheating of wires and electrical components is left unchecked or if there are combustible materials nearby.

What should I do if I notice electrical overloading in my office?

If you notice signs of electrical overloading in your office, such as flickering lights, popping sounds, or burning smells, you should immediately unplug any appliances in the area and seek professional electrical assistance to avoid any potential hazards.
